Two bugs from the formatting work, both visible in the CRM messenger:
1. Inline code / code blocks were invisible in your OWN bubbles. `.miu-code` sets
background: --miu-panel-2 (#1d1d26) while the is-mine override set only the
colour to --miu-accent-text (#1a1206) — near-black on near-black, ~1.03:1
contrast. The chip now tints the accent bubble (rgba(0,0,0,.16)) instead of
using the panel colour, so it reads against any accent.
2. The conversation list showed the raw last message, so a strikethrough message
previewed as "~crazy~". Adds stripMarkup() — markers off, code unwrapped,
nesting handled, honouring the same word-boundary rule so snake_case_name and
"5 * 3" survive — and uses it for the preview line.
Bumped to 0.1.10. SDK suite: 17 files / 98 tests green.

Composer becomes a <textarea> so the PLATFORM supplies text services: red
spellcheck squiggles, right-click suggestions / add-to-dictionary, and mobile
autocorrect (spellCheck + autoCorrect + autoCapitalize). Nothing shipped for it.
Previously a single-line <input>, which Firefox does not spellcheck by default
(layout.spellcheckDefault=1 checks multi-line only) and which could not hold a
multi-line message at all. Enter sends, Shift+Enter (and IME composition) makes a
newline, and the box grows with content.
WhatsApp-style markup: *bold*, _italic_, ~strike~, `code`, ```fenced blocks```,
plus bare URLs. Cmd/Ctrl+B/I/E and a small toolbar wrap the selection in markers.
Messages stay PLAIN TEXT on the wire, so stored history and older clients are
unaffected — formatting is purely a render concern.
renderRichText() returns a ReactNode tree and never uses dangerouslySetInnerHTML,
so message text cannot inject markup; links are restricted to http/https/mailto
(safeHref) to close the javascript: vector. Code is tokenized first and its
contents stay literal; markers require word boundaries so snake_case_name and
"5 * 3" are not mangled.
Bumped to 0.1.9. SDK suite: 17 files / 95 tests green.

Phase C of channel-roster import. Adds the optional addMembers(threadId, userIds)
adapter seam (+ BulkAddResult) and, in ConversationSettings, a '#' mode on the
existing Add-people box that lists the channels you belong to — public AND
private, since the source list is your own membership-scoped conversation list.
Picking a channel STAGES the import (reads its roster, diffs against who is
already here) and shows a confirm — 'Add 9 people from #design? (3 already here)'
— so an administrative action never fires on a stray click. The result line
reports added / already-a-member / failed. Absent addMembers => the affordance is
hidden entirely and '#' is just a search string.
Bumped to 0.1.8. SDK suite: 15 files / 78 tests green.

Replies (messages with parentInteractionId) now open in a right-hand ThreadPane
instead of inline quoting:
- extracted a shared Composer (draft + @mention autocomplete + attach) and
MessageItem (bubble + mentions + attachment + reactions + reply affordance)
- Thread shows top-level messages only; a message with replies gets a
'💬 N replies' link, and hovering shows 💬 'Reply in thread'
- ThreadPane renders the root + its replies + a composer that posts back with
parentInteractionId; Messenger becomes 3-column (list | thread | pane),
pane closes on conversation switch
- no contract/adapter/backend change (parentInteractionId was already wired)
- thread-pane render test (open → reply → parent shows the count); 58 green

Adds a third membership beyond dm/group: a discoverable, joinable room.
- contract: Membership += 'channel'; Conversation.topic; ChannelSummary +
CreateChannelInput; optional adapter methods browseChannels/createChannel/
joinChannel/leaveChannel (capability-degrading — absent hides the UI)
- MockAdapter implements them (seeds a joined public, a joinable public, and a
private channel); listConversations now returns only threads I'm in
- useChannels hook (browse/create/join/leave + supported flag)
- UI: sidebar sections (Channels vs Direct messages), a + that opens a
ChannelBrowser (join + create), # / lock glyphs; themeable styles
- KernelClientAdapter passes channel membership + topic through
- 4 channel tests (mock browse/join/create + render browse→join); 52 total green

Turns the SDK from hooks-only into a real UI SDK: <Messenger> (conversation
list + open thread + composer), plus <ConversationList> and <Thread>, all
driven by the existing useConversations/useMessages hooks over the injected
adapter — zero transport imports (boundary intact).
- themeable via --miu-* CSS variables; default theme ships as ./styles.css
- optimistic send, typing indicator, seen ticks, reactions display, unread badges
- render smoke tests (jsdom + MockAdapter): mounts, auto-selects first thread,
sends a message, switches threads (3 tests) — 48 total green
- tsup: css bundled to dist/styles.css; dts scoped to TS entries
